@@ -176,8 +176,7 @@ useful for us, so it might be useful for you. To get a heap dump, compile
with ``-d:nimTypeNames`` and call ``dumpNumberOfInstances`` at a strategic place in your program.
This produces a list of used types in your program and for every type
the total amount of object instances for this type as well as the total
amount of bytes these instances take up. This list is currently unsorted!
You need to use external shell script hacking to sort it.
amount of bytes these instances take up.
